[未解決] 商品一覧ページで複数SKUにした場合、同じSKUが2回表示される。

ホーム フォーラム 使い方全般 [未解決] 商品一覧ページで複数SKUにした場合、同じSKUが2回表示される。

このトピックには4件の返信が含まれ、2人の参加者がいます。5 年、 3 ヶ月前 seedmaster さんが最後の更新を行いました。

5件の投稿を表示中 - 1 - 5件目 (全5件中)
  • 投稿者
    投稿
  • #52826

    seedmaster
    参加者

    下記ページにおいて、SKUを2つ設定した場合、商品一覧ページでのみ最初のSKUが2回表示されてしまいます。

    http://opera-carmen.sakura.ne.jp/koitofu/item/

    商品毎のシングルページだとこのような問題は無いのですが、どうしたら解決できるでしょうか?

    宜しくお願い致します。

    #66940

    nanbu
    参加者

    こんにては。

    こちらのページは固定ページですか?

    SKUのループの際に、既に読み込まれているSKUが表示されている為ではないかと思います。

    商品詳細ページのテンプレートにならって、

    do{ }while(usces_have_skus());

    としてみて下さい。

    #66941

    seedmaster
    参加者

    早速のお返事ありがとうございます。

    このページは、商品詳細ページのテンプレートをcategory.phpへコピーして、

    <?php while (have_posts()) : the_post(); ?>

    で商品の数だけループさせている感じです。

    商品詳細ページのテンプレートをそのまま使っている下記のページでは正しく表示されるのですが。。

    http://opera-carmen.sakura.ne.jp/koitofu/item/koitofu/

    お教え頂いた

    do{ }while(usces_have_skus());

    はどの箇所に挿入するのがよいのでしょうか?

    お手数ですが、ご教授頂けますと幸いに存じます。

    何卒よろしくお願い致します。

    #66942

    nanbu
    参加者

    商品詳細ページのテンプレートwc_single_item.phpを参考にしてください。

    #66943

    seedmaster
    参加者

    何度もすみません。

    商品詳細のテンプレートwc_item_single.phpに倣い、do{ }while(usces_have_skus());でループさせてみましたが、やはり最初のskuが2回表示されてしまいます。

    商品詳細ページの方は同じコードで問題が無いのですが、カテゴリーページで使うと問題が起きている状態です。

    商品カテゴリーページ http://opera-carmen.sakura.ne.jp/koitofu/item/koitofu/

    商品詳細ページ http://opera-carmen.sakura.ne.jp/koitofu/item/koitofu/

5件の投稿を表示中 - 1 - 5件目 (全5件中)

このトピックに返信するにはログインが必要です。